Wendell Marlyn Smith

June 18, 1926 — March 13, 2013

Wendell Marlyn Smith, 86, of Seminole, FL formerly of New Berlin, PA passed away at 2:21 PM on Wednesday, March 13, 2013 at Pacifca Senior Living Center, Clearwater, FL.

He was born on June 18, 1926 in New Berlin, the son of the late Bruce M. and L. Catherine (Spangler) Smith. On March 07, 1951, he married the former Betty Mae Shultz, who passed away on September 11, 1987.

Wendell attended Lewisburg Area High School.

Mr. Smith enlisted in the U.S. Army in 1944; where he earned the rank of Master Sgt working in the financial department. He served honorably until retirement in 1965. Then in 1969 he began working at the Susquehanna University Bookstore as store manager, until his retirement in 1989.

Wendell was a member of the Fort Knox Masonic Lodge #550 F&AM, Fort Knox, KY, a 32nd Degree Mason of the Scottish Rite, and the American Legion Post #957, New Berlin.

Wendell enjoyed operating his Ham radio.

Surviving are one son and daughter-in-law, Robert M. and Barbara Ann Smith of Seminole, FL, one grandson, Mark Wendell Smith, granddaughter, Thea Marie Smith.

Private graveside services with full military honors accorded by Veterans of the Mifflinburg American Legion Post #410 were held in the New Berlin Cemetery.
